Evolution of Accommodations for Automobile Travel

During the early 20th century, the evolution of accommodations for automobile travel marked a significant shift in the hospitality industry. As more people embraced road trips and travel by car, hotels began adapting to cater to this new mode of transportation. These establishments strategically positioned themselves along popular roadways and highways to provide convenient resting places for weary travelers and road trippers.

The concept of drive-up motels emerged, allowing guests to park their vehicles directly in front of their rooms for easy access. This innovation revolutionized the guest experience, offering convenience and comfort tailored specifically to the needs of motorists. Motel rooms featured amenities such as carports, providing shelter for vehicles from the elements, and streamlined check-in processes to cater to travelers on the go.

Additionally, hotels started incorporating elements like roadside signage and distinctive architectural designs to attract the attention of passing motorists. The evolution of accommodations for automobile travel was not merely about providing a place to stay but creating memorable experiences that complemented the freedom and mobility associated with road trips. This shift in approach laid the foundation for the modern concept of road trip accommodations and set the stage for continued innovation in automotive hospitality.

Architectural Adaptations

Architectural adaptations in hotels during the automobile age were crucial for accommodating the influx of road travelers. Facades featured prominent entrances facing the road, with streamlined designs for easy access. Lobbies were designed to showcase elegance while providing convenient parking spaces nearby.

Additionally, hotels incorporated motor courts or drive-up accommodations, allowing guests to park next to their rooms for speedy check-ins and departures. There was a focus on creating a cohesive experience between the automobile and the hotel’s layout, with amenities such as garages, gas stations, and car wash facilities seamlessly integrated into the property.

These architectural changes aimed to cater to the needs and preferences of automobile travelers, emphasizing convenience and accessibility.
